One such occasion was noticed in September 2022, when researchers from Yale College have been inspecting their latest observations from the Hubble Area Telescope. They noticed an uncommon characteristic, that appeared like a particularly lengthy and skinny straight line, subsequent to a galaxy over 10 billion mild years away.

The Linear Characteristic. Picture Credit score: Van Dokkum et al., 2023
At first the researchers thought they’d missed a stray cosmic ray whereas processing their observations, which then lit up just some pixels of their digicam. Fortunately, the telescope can observe a number of totally different sorts of sunshine by way of its totally different filters, and a single cosmic ray ought to solely be seen at one filter. Weirdly sufficient, the road characteristic could possibly be seen in all observations no matter filter, so it couldn’t have been as a consequence of a stray ray. In actuality, it was one thing much more thrilling.
Wanting deeper into it, the skinny line pointed straight on the centre of a close-by dwarf galaxy. Dwarf galaxies, whereas not as massive or shiny as our personal Milky Means, are nonetheless large constructions, and the bizarre line was nearly half as shiny as its neighbour. By inspecting the sunshine properties noticed from the road and the galaxy, the astronomers discovered that the 2 objects contained some related chemical components and have been additionally on the similar distance from the Earth. This was vital, as a result of the road gave the impression to be some 200 thousand mild years lengthy, even longer than the Milky Means galaxy, and for much longer than its dwarf companion. No matter this odd line was, it was completely huge! Not having a transparent thought what to make of it, the astronomer determined to have a look at this odd pair once more with their subsequent set of observations.
After taking a better look, they discovered that the road was not the one uncommon factor about this. The galaxy it pointed at was examined rigorously and located to have some attention-grabbing qualities. It was small and compact, irregular in form, and was forming stars at a a lot greater price than anticipated for a galaxy of its form, nearly 10 instances greater! These outcomes prompt that this galaxy had modified drastically not too way back. About 100 million years in its previous (which isn’t that lengthy for a galaxy!), the galaxy had merged with one other dwarf galaxy in a spiralling celestial dance. The results of two galaxies merging is a brand new, brighter galaxy, with greater charges of star formation and the entire stars of its two earlier elements. A galaxy is a large construction containing billions of stars held collectively by gravity. The center of a galaxy is its brightest half, due to many many stars gathering shut collectively, lighting it up brilliantly. Regardless of its heat mild although, a galaxy’s coronary heart accommodates one other, darker half. An enormous black gap, weighing hundreds of thousands of instances the mass of the Solar, lurks within the coronary heart of each galaxy. That’s over a billion trillion trillion tons! When two galaxies collide and merge, the black holes of their hearts additionally begin to work together. Often the 2 mix into one other, larger black gap, but when a 3rd galaxy comes alongside earlier than the merge is full, we get a 3rd big black gap to work together with the merging pair. The third black gap can “kick” the smaller of the pair and ship it flying out and away from the galaxy at blazing velocity. That is a particularly uncommon occasion to look at, so we’re nonetheless undecided of the precise sequence of interactions that happen, or how it will look from so far-off!

Might this actually be what precipitated the weird line within the observations? The astronomers thought of many alternative attainable explanations. At first they thought it could possibly be a super-thin galaxy seen from the facet, however that doesn’t match with the symmetry of the characteristic, its excessive brightness and its intense star formation charges. All essentially the most viable explanations required the presence of a super-massive black gap, so subsequent they thought the noticed line could possibly be a large jet coming from an lively galactic centre. That may be straightforward to confirm, as a result of these all the time produce very excessive quantities of X-rays. The noticed characteristic confirmed nearly no X-rays, in order that clarification was additionally dominated out. It could possibly be {that a} jet had been there up to now coming from the “host” dwarf galaxy which had shocked the area into excessive star formation and had then turned off. In that case, we’d see the shocked area getting wider because it moved away from the galaxy, opening up like a cone. The noticed characteristic was really getting narrower because it moved away from the galaxy, prefer it was created by one thing leaving the galaxy as a substitute of by the galaxy itself. The astronomers have been left with just one clarification: an enormous black gap had been ejected from the galaxy and was now travelling by way of the universe, surprising interstellar house in its path and inflicting stars to kind!

Artist’s impression of the runaway black gap shifting away from its former host galaxy. Picture Credit score: NASA, ESA, Leah Hustak (STScI)
This cosmic bullet is a very uncommon and mind-boggling occasion. A hungry black gap, 40 instances bigger than the Solar and weighing 10 million instances extra, is hurling by way of house with a velocity calculated at 16,000 kilometers per second, 4,000 instances quicker than a rocket ship. The main researcher of this discovering, skilled extragalactic astronomer Pieter van Dokkum, known as this a “serendipitous discovery” and a “outstanding characteristic”.
